The UK Government has pulled the families of staff out of the region as a precaution because it’s worried Brits could be targeted in the war between Iran and the US and Israel

Families of UK Government staff living in Israel have fled Tel Aviv because Iran could target them in the ongoing war.

In a stark update released on Tuesday afternoon (April 14), officials confirmed the urgent move, saying dependents had been pulled out as a precaution while tensions spiral across the region.

The official statement from the government reads: “We have taken the precautionary measure temporarily to withdraw dependants of UK staff from Tel Aviv. Our Embassy continues to operate as normal.”

But the warning doesn’t stop there. Authorities painted a chilling picture of a situation that could explode at any moment. “The situation could escalate quickly and poses significant risks. Regional tensions may cause international borders (air and land) to close,” it added.

Fears of attacks are mounting, with the government sounding the alarm over incoming fire from the skies. It said: “There is a risk of rocket and drone attacks throughout Israel. There is a risk of shrapnel from intercepted missiles falling across Israel and Palestine, and possible disruption at Ben Gurion airport in Tel Aviv.”

Meanwhile, unrest on the ground could add fuel to the fire, with the government saying: “Political tension can cause demonstrations and clashes around anniversaries and significant events.”

The Foreign, Commonwealth and Development Office (FCDO) is now advising against all travel to Israel and Palestine, as the region teeters on the brink.

Brits in the area are being told to stay glued to local updates and follow emergency instructions. Guidance includes checking local media and following the Israeli Home Front Command.

To get help:

  • Visit the Israeli Home Front Command website (available in Israel only)
  • Call 104 if you are in Israel

Travellers have also been warned to think twice before making any movements.

Before travelling within Israel or Palestine, check the local measures in place, that roads are open and, where appropriate, that scheduled train and bus services are operating.

Travel within or out of Israel or Palestine is at your own risk. You are encouraged to follow the advice of local authorities, for example on which routes are open or when to take shelter.
